Brian C. Kunzler is the founder of Kunzler, PC, now Kunzler Bean & Adamson. He has a b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ering with a minor in computer science from Utah State University. He received his law degree with honors from Brigham Young University, and has practiced law since 1994. Brian has extensive expertise acquiring, licensing, and enforcing patents in the fields of electrical devices and electronics, computers and computer software, medical arts, hydrocarbon engines, and mechanical devices.

Brian has prepared patent applications for numerous Fortune 500 companies, emerging software and Internet companies, as well as individuals and start-up ventures. He also has extensive experience in and regularly counsels clients in the areas of trademarks, copyrights, computer law, licensing, trade secrets, and intellectual property litigation and litigation avoidance.

Brian currently represents clients including IBM Corporation, Motorola, Lenovo, local universities, software and Internet companies, as well as many other companies and individuals located in Utah and throughout the country.

Brian has been admitted to practice before the state and federal courts in Utah, the United States Court of Appeals for the Federal Circuit, and the United States Patent and Trademark Office. He is a member of the American Intellectual Property Law Association and the Utah State Bar Intellectual Property Section. He is conversant in Mandarin Chinese. He is active in community affairs and frequently lectures on intellectual property law topics to practitioners and business groups.
